Richard - Verified booking
We chose this location as it was perfect to visit the various parts of Cornwall we wanted to see -Tintagel, Port Isaac, Looe, Polperro, Mousehole, Porthcurno Beach, Kynance Cove and The Lizard.
We visited more locations thanks to the info that the owners Jill, Trudy and Richard gave us. We were absolutely delighted with their welcome. The lodge is superb and has a full range of appliances that you would want - dishwasher, washing machine, microwave, TV with DVD player, Wi-Fi and more. It is very clean indeed and has all the materials you would need - just as if you were at home. Lots of towels and, even lots of coat hangers for your clothing The peaceful surroundings were very special to us as we come from the very busy south-east. The location is not far outside Bodmin and the local village of Lanivet has some stores and a pub that we dined in. The lodge was so much bigger than we expected and it was so comfortable. It has double glazing and the walls too have insulation, keeping a comfortable temperature which we found very welcome on returning on a chilly night after a long day out. To summarise, if you are wanting a large, very comfortable, fully-equiped lodge in quiet and beautiful surroundings, with car parking outside, with easy reach of the many great sites of Cornwall, DON'T HESITATE - BOOK THIS!!
